Bugs item #2075241, was opened at 2008-08-26 09:22 Message generated for change (Comment added) made by stmane You can respond by visiting: https://sourceforge.net/tracker/?func=detail&atid=482468&aid=2075241&group_id=56967
Please note that this message will contain a full copy of the comment thread, including the initial issue submission, for this request, not just the latest update. Category: SQL/Core Group: MonetDB5 "stable" >Status: Open Resolution: Fixed >Priority: 6 Private: No Submitted By: Jane Chen (cjnn) Assigned to: Niels Nes (nielsnes) Summary: When the NULL is in a column,it shouldn't add primary key Initial Comment: OS: RedHat Linux AS 4 GCC: 3.4.6 1.setup: create table A ( test int ); insert into A (test) values (NULL); 2.execute: alter table A add constraint test1 primary key (test); 3.result: The operation is successful, but the table has "null". ---------------------------------------------------------------------- >Comment By: Stefan Manegold (stmane) Date: 2009-08-13 20:03 Message: re-opened as the test fails, again, since checkin on 2009/08/05 on the Aug2009 branch, now complaining QUERY = alter table A add constraint test1 primary key (test, id); ERROR = !CONSTRAINT PRIMARY KEY: a table can have only one PRIMARY KEY cf., http://monetdb.cwi.nl/testing/projects/monetdb/Stable/sql/.mTests103/GNU.64.64.d.1-Fedora10/src_test_BugTracker-2008/alter_add_constraint_should_check_existing_data.SF-2075241.err.00.html http://monetdb.cwi.nl/testing/projects/monetdb/Stable/sql/.mTests103/GNU.64.64.d.1-Fedora10/src_test_BugTracker-2008/alter_add_constraint_should_check_existing_data.SF-2075241.out.00.html ---------------------------------------------------------------------- Comment By: Romulo Goncalves (romulog) Date: 2008-11-14 14:54 Message: The fix for this bug were the check ins: [Monetdb-sql-checkins] sql/src/server sql_schema.mx, Nov2008, 1.152, 1.152.2.1 [Monetdb-sql-checkins] sql/src/server sql_updates.mx, Nov2008, 1.153, 1.153.2.1 [Monetdb-sql-checkins] sql/src/storage store.mx, Nov2008, 1.22, 1.22.2.1 ---------------------------------------------------------------------- Comment By: Niels Nes (nielsnes) Date: 2008-08-26 15:52 Message: Logged In: YES user_id=43556 Originator: NO added test alter_add_constraint_should_check_existing_data.SF-2075241.sql . We currently don't check constraints when added to an existing column/table. ---------------------------------------------------------------------- You can respond by visiting: https://sourceforge.net/tracker/?func=detail&atid=482468&aid=2075241&group_id=56967 ------------------------------------------------------------------------------ Let Crystal Reports handle the reporting - Free Crystal Reports 2008 30-Day trial. Simplify your report design, integration and deployment - and focus on what you do best, core application coding. Discover what's new with Crystal Reports now. http://p.sf.net/sfu/bobj-july _______________________________________________ Monetdb-bugs mailing list [email protected] https://lists.sourceforge.net/lists/listinfo/monetdb-bugs
